National Instruments PCIE 1429

Hi,

I am using a monochrome Basler Cameralink Camera(A504K)of resolution 1280x1024 with a card grabber PCIE-1429 (x4 slot). The image acquisition is controlled through MAX  of LabVIEW version 11.0.1. The problem is that when I try to reduce the number of rows(more specifically Height) from 1024 to 32(say)in the acquisition window(of MAX), the frame rate of the camera should increase almost upto 16,000fps. But it is not going beyond 248fps. Can you suggest  me, why is it so happening, Or How to increase its frame rate? Also, below the image window there appeared something like: 1280x32    1X   8-bit image  9. What does 1X actually mean here?For your ready reference I am also attaching the image of the acquisation window.

I assume you will need to install Basler's CCT+ to configure the camera framerate via the serial interface of CL. To enable serial communication via CL you have to open MAX, go to Tools>NI Vision> Select CLSer Nat Systems.
